The project aims to introduce into clinical practice for Caesarean section conducted under general anesthesia with the rapid induction myorelaxation with rocuronium and the reversal of neuromuscular blockade by using sugammadex. The aim is to demonstrate at least the same efficiency and confirm the safety of the procedure for both mother and newborn compared with older procedure.
Project "Modern myorelaxation procedure and reversal of neuromuscular blockade during general anesthesia for caesarean section" aims to introduce in other indications for rapid induction of general anesthesia common and safe, alternative method of combining short-acting intravenous anesthetics propofol and fast-onset non-depolarizing muscle relaxant rocuronium into the clinical practice and demonstrate the efficacy and safety in this indication. At the same time to demonstrate the benefits of using modern reversal of neuromuscular blockade by sugammadex in termination the caesarean section under general anesthesia. Both procedures will be monitored by clinical observation, monitoring instrumentation and laboratory examination of mother and fetus (newborn) in various stages of peripartal period. The main benefit of this procedure will be in particular risk groups of mothers which are indicated by Caesarean Section while neuraxial blockade is contraindicated.

Administration of rocuronium 1 mg/kg, intubation at decrease in Single Twitch to 10% of baseline event. by the disappearance of visible spikes event. in the 60th seconds after administration of muscle relaxants. Anesthesia with sevoflurane according to the MAC, neuromuscular blockade TOF count at 1-2.At the end of operation at PTC 1-2 sugammadex 4 mg/kg, at the TOF count 1-2, sugammadex 2 mg/kg, in the case of failure to achieve these values the anesthesiologist will wait until the minimum value of PTC 1-2 will be achieved. In can not intubate can not ventilate, and the failure of the introduction of laryngeal masks sugammadex 16mg/kg, immediately following the discovery of this fact and wait for the recovery of muscle strength. Time to recovery is recorded.
1mg/kg succinylcholine iodide, intubation after decrease in Single Twitch to 10% of baseline event. after the disappearance of visible fasciculation event. in the 60th seconds after administration of muscle relaxants. Anesthesia with sevoflurane according to the MAC, at the moment of 20-30% of the original value of Single Twitch rocuronium 0.3 mg / kg, maintaining TOF Count at 1-2.At the end of operation at TOF Count 1-2 atropine 0.01 mg/kg and neostigmine 0.03 mg/kg. If TOF not 1-2 wait.In can not intubate can not ventilate, wait for the spontaneous recovery. Time to recovery of muscle strength is recorded.

time needed to tracheal intubation
Quality: Rapid induction to general anesthesia with administration propofol and rocuronium for termination the pregnancy by Caesarean section are at least as good as the combination of propofol and succinylcholine iodide.Recording and evaluated will be the time from the beginning as the first drug in the rapid induction to general anesthesia will be administered until the discovery of the first wave of etCO2 after successful intubation (seconds), evaluation of intubation conditions (resistance to laryngoscopy, position of the vocal cords, response to the intubation attempt (limbs movement or cough) scored 1-3 according to level terms, conditions, entry scores for direct visualization of the vocal cords by Cormack-Lehane (I-IV)

total procedure time
Economics: After reversal of neuromuscular blockade using sugammadex are procedure time and turnovers shorter than the use of neostigmine in the recommended dosage for patients undergoing termination of pregnancy by Caesarean section. Recording and evaluated will be the total procedure time until the recovery from neuromuscular blockade to the level of TOF ratio of 0.9, the administration of the recovery dose will in group ROCSUG in the case for posttetanic count mode in the level of PTC1, 2 at a dose of sugammadex 4mg/kg , the TOF count 1.2 sugammadex at a dose of 2 mg / kg, in the case of failure to achieve these values the anesthesiologist wil wait with the administration of the recovery dose for their achievement. In group SUCNEO for achieving TOF count 1.2 and higher, the dose of atropine to 0.01 mg / kg and neostigmine 0.03 mg / kg will be administered.
